     Caribe is our Saint Phillip daughter.  Her sire, and her dam, Whittling, were in the Virginia
     State University (VSU) Research Flock and were purchased by James Harper originally.     
     When James gifted the sheep to several members of the BBSAI, Caribe's mother went to  
     Josh Weimer (the acting president of the BBSAI at the time) with Caribe at her side as a
     young lamb.  She traveled from Virginia to Missouri, then when Josh dispersed his flock,
     we purchased Caribe and also Red Shanks (another VSU Research Flock purchase by     
     James Harper) and brought them to Texas in May of 2006. 

     Caribe has always been an exceptional ewe.  Her first lambing for us produced Lone
     Star Becky and Lone Star Waylan, both had beautiful conformation and size and perfect
     heads that were completely scur-free. (See Waylan's picture on our "Ram Policy" page). 

     Next Caribe had a very unusual pregnancy, which I have found in researching, is not as
     uncommon as I had originally thought.  On March 4, 2008, Caribe gave birth to Lone
     Star Brown Sugar.  Then on April 11, 2008, about five weeks later, she lambed Lone
     Star Bacardi, Lone Star Bequais and Lone Star Jolyon.  The concensus with our vet
     and the BBSAI was that Caribe had produced quadruplets. 

     After the quadruplets, Caribe gave birth to Lone Star Harley and Lone Star Don Diego
     along with a ewe lamb that did not survive.  Triplets.

     Her following delivery produced Lone Star Caracas and Lone Star Havanna.

     All of Caribe's lambs have been outstanding specimens of the breed.   All of her
     ram lambs have gone on to be herd sires at other breeder's farms.  They are listed
     on our "Ewes" page along with Bailey who was born at Josh Weimer's farm, sired
     by #13 Calvin.   Most of Caribe's ewe lambs were kept for breeding purposes because
     of the consistent quality she produced.  We have let three of her ewe lambs go to other    
     breeders so her genes could be utilized and dispersed within the breed.

     Caribe, as I said, has always been an exceptional ewe and we are proud to say that
     she is one of our foundation ewes.  She has always lambed unassisted, and no matter
     how many lambs she delivered, we have never had to supplement feed her lambs.  She
     always took care of the feeding by herself.  Plus she is a fantastic mother.
